A little overwhelmed....
Last Friday Jim officially got on Home Based Primary Care. An ARNP is replacing his primary care doctor, and she will visit him at home. Yesterday, a licensed nutritionist came and talked about special things Jim needs to eat because of his health problems. He should be eating five to six small meals a day, nothing with concentrated sugar, and very little canned food. She hinted that I should not bring that kind of stuff into the home. Maybe she would like to deal with Jim's temper...and I live here, too, don't I? Depressing and overwhelming. I'm not eating much lately anyway.
